Jon Stewart Dedicates Entire Show to 9/11 First Responders Bill
In case you missed it, Jon Stewart spent the entirety of his final show of 2010 on the Zadroga health care bill for 9/11 first responders. In this clip, he holds a panel discussion with four actual 9/11 first responders.

The Senate has turned down the attempt to move ahead with a defense bill that would repeal the ban on gay troops serving openly in the military. The vote was 57-40, three short of the 60 needed.
Republicans defeated a motion that would have cut off debate on an overall defense authorization bill, including repeal.

Would you ever ask a man that question?
– Secretary of State Hillary Clinton, responding to a question about what clothing designers she prefers. The question was asked on Clinton’s visit to Kyrgyzstan, just moments after she made a point about sexism and the scrutiny women face—that men don’t—regarding clothing. (via officialssay)
